fix(explore): invalid "No Filter" applied (#24876)

This commit is contained in:
JUST.in DO IT 2023-08-03 06:17:56 -07:00 committed by GitHub
parent f05638ba84
commit 371bffbfea
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
1 changed files with 3 additions and 1 deletions

View File

@ -21,6 +21,7 @@ import { SupersetClient, t } from '@superset-ui/core';
import { addSuccessToast } from 'src/components/MessageToasts/actions';
import { isEmpty } from 'lodash';
import { buildV1ChartDataPayload } from '../exploreUtils';
import { Operators } from '../constants';
const ADHOC_FILTER_REGEX = /^adhoc_filters/;
@ -81,7 +82,8 @@ export const getSlicePayload = (
if (
isEmpty(adhocFilters?.adhoc_filters) &&
isEmpty(formDataFromSlice) &&
formDataWithNativeFilters?.adhoc_filters?.length > 0
formDataWithNativeFilters?.adhoc_filters?.[0]?.operator ===
Operators.TEMPORAL_RANGE
) {
adhocFilters.adhoc_filters = [
{